Definition of chaotically - Reverso English Dictionary
Adverb
disorderRare in a way that is very disorganized or unpredictableRare
- The papers were scattered chaotically across the desk.
- The children ran chaotically through the playground.
- Cars were parked chaotically along the street.
Origin of chaotically
Greek, khaos (abyss) + -ically (in a manner)
